The Department offers B.A. Programme, B.A. (Hons.) and M.A. Courses with an emphasis on
reading the original texts and sources. The stud1e0nts are also introduced to critical analysis through
commentaries and other modern approaches. The department also offers concurrent, qualifying
and Interdisciplinary courses (Nationalism and Indian Literature) for first year and concurrent paper
for second year Honours courses.
